| #include "config.h" |
| |
| #include "ExecutableAllocator.h" |
| |
| #if ENABLE(ASSEMBLER) && OS(UNIX) && !OS(SYMBIAN) |
| |
| #include <sys/mman.h> |
| #include <unistd.h> |
| #include <wtf/VMTags.h> |
| |
| namespace JSC { |
| |
| #if !(OS(DARWIN) && CPU(X86_64)) |
| |
| void ExecutableAllocator::intializePageSize() |
| { |
| ExecutableAllocator::pageSize = getpagesize(); |
| } |
| |
| ExecutablePool::Allocation ExecutablePool::systemAlloc(size_t n) |
| { |
| void* allocation = mmap(NULL, n, INITIAL_PROTECTION_FLAGS, MAP_PRIVATE | MAP_ANON, VM_TAG_FOR_EXECUTABLEALLOCATOR_MEMORY, 0); |
| if (allocation == MAP_FAILED) |
| CRASH(); |
| ExecutablePool::Allocation alloc = { reinterpret_cast<char*>(allocation), n }; |
| return alloc; |
| } |
| |
| void ExecutablePool::systemRelease(const ExecutablePool::Allocation& alloc) |
| { |
| int result = munmap(alloc.pages, alloc.size); |
| ASSERT_UNUSED(result, !result); |
| } |
| |
| #endif // !(OS(DARWIN) && CPU(X86_64)) |
| |
| #if ENABLE(ASSEMBLER_WX_EXCLUSIVE) |
| void ExecutableAllocator::reprotectRegion(void* start, size_t size, ProtectionSeting setting) |
| { |
| if (!pageSize) |
| intializePageSize(); |
| |
| // Calculate the start of the page containing this region, |
| // and account for this extra memory within size. |
| intptr_t startPtr = reinterpret_cast<intptr_t>(start); |
| intptr_t pageStartPtr = startPtr & ~(pageSize - 1); |
| void* pageStart = reinterpret_cast<void*>(pageStartPtr); |
| size += (startPtr - pageStartPtr); |
| |
| // Round size up |
| size += (pageSize - 1); |
| size &= ~(pageSize - 1); |
| |
| mprotect(pageStart, size, (setting == Writable) ? PROTECTION_FLAGS_RW : PROTECTION_FLAGS_RX); |
| } |
| #endif |
| |
| } |
| |
| #endif // HAVE(ASSEMBLER) |
